Expectant and new mothers are denied loans, says report
Banks are discriminating against women, particularly those who are pregnant or on maternity leave, according to a study.
Deputy Prime Minister Nick Clegg has promised to investigate the claims that women are being denied mortgages and loans on the basis of their gender.
A think-tank report from Cambridge professor Noreena Hertz claims banks in Britain, Europe and the U.S. are treating women as second class citizens.
This is denied by the banks, which have dismissed the claims as unreliable and unsubstantiated.
